Hello Tavia,

Welcome aboard. As a new contractor on the Lanternmoor integration team, you'll be on call for the partner SFTP drop. Partners upload nightly batch files between 01:00 and 03:00 local time; a watcher validates checksums and moves files into the ingest queue. Most pages are missing-file alerts, which usually resolve by morning. Full triage steps, including when to contact the partner liaison, are on the internal page below.

operations page: https://jenkins.zemvarcloud.local/job/merge_requests/repo/build/73930b4b30f0a8ed

# Vendored fonts configuration
#
# As of release 4.2 we vendor the Kestrelbrook type family directly
# into /assets/fonts rather than fetching at build time. This avoids
# the CDN outage class of failure we hit during the Marwick launch.
# License files live alongside each family; the release manager must
# confirm they ship in the tarball. Font usage metrics are recorded
# per-build into the telemetry store so we can retire unused weights.
# The telemetry writer connects using the string below:

primary connection of yaguf-tagug = mongodb://sorox_svc:RmJoU4HZbLmruH@db-0593.qorvelworks.internal:5432/fraius

Runbook — Deed Transfers (Velmora Title Co.)

Quick reminder for whoever's covering the front office: the notarised deed for the Harkwell Mews property comes back from the notary Thursday morning. Don't leave it in the general mail tray — it goes straight into the grey lockbox by Priya's desk. The courier from Bramblefleet Express is booked for a same-day run to the registry in Oakenshaw. Before they leave, confirm the seal is intact and the folder is taped shut. The hand-over instruction for the courier is as follows.

dispatch memo: the lamwyn fenwyn courier leaves the wenir ledger at gate 7175 under passcode 822969